What energy is nuclear fission?

Answer:

Nuclear energy

Explanation:

All nuclear power plants use nuclear fission, and most nuclear power plants use uranium atoms. During nuclear fission, a neutron collides with a uranium atom and splits it, releasing a large amount of energy in the form of heat and radiation.

"A mother is angry about her son’s diagnosis of osteosarcoma. She is telling him that if he had not played football last year an
Paraphin [41]

Answer:

Playing sports does not cause osteosarcoma

Explanation:

Osteosarcoma is a bone cancer that begins in the cells that forms bones.

Common symptoms of Osteosarcoma are; tumor that can be felt through the skin, bone pain, restriction in movement, limping and so on.

If the disease has not spread to other part of the body, the survival rate is around seventy -to seventy-five percent but if osteosarcoma has spread to other part of the body the survival rate is about thirty percent.

For treatment, chemotherapy and chemotherapy drug should be administered.
